Natalee Caple previous novels, "Mackerel Sky" and "The Plight of Happy People in an Ordinary World," earned high international praise. Her collection of poetry, "A More Tender Ocean," was shortlisted for the Gerald Lampert Memorial Award. Caple’s work has been optioned for film and nominated for a National Magazine Award, the Journey Prize, the RBC Bronwen Wallace Award, and the Eden Mills Fiction Award. She lives in Ontario, Canada.
